The Role
The successful candidate will join the Central Sustainability Office (CSO) to support the development of our approach to nature. This will include supporting the development of a Group-wide nature strategy, supporting the integration of nature into our climate frameworks, and supporting the integration of nature risks into our Risk Management Framework. They will need to work closely and effectively with a broad range of stakeholders across M&G Plc, our life insurance business and our asset management business. They will be part of a Climate & Nature team, with ongoing opportunities to interact with climate workstreams.
